The vCPU APIs have API-specific flag enums that alias the generic VIR_DOMAIN_AFFECT_* values for live and config state.
Use the vCPU-specific aliases in the public API checks, QEMU driver flag masks, and virsh flag construction. The values are unchanged; this is only a consistency cleanup. Signed-off-by: Akash Kulhalli <[email protected]> --- src/libvirt-domain.c | 4 ++-- src/qemu/qemu_driver.c | 8 ++++---- tools/virsh-domain.c | 8 ++++---- 3 files changed, 10 insertions(+), 10 deletions(-) diff --git a/src/libvirt-domain.c b/src/libvirt-domain.c index a4cbeb8ad486..a37cc741351a 100644 --- a/src/libvirt-domain.c +++ b/src/libvirt-domain.c @@ -7803,11 +7803,11 @@ virDomainSetVcpusFlags(virDomainPtr domain, unsigned int nvcpus, virCheckReadOnlyGoto(domain->conn->flags, error); VIR_REQUIRE_FLAG_GOTO(VIR_DOMAIN_VCPU_MAXIMUM, - VIR_DOMAIN_AFFECT_CONFIG, + VIR_DOMAIN_VCPU_CONFIG, error); VIR_EXCLUSIVE_FLAGS_GOTO(VIR_DOMAIN_VCPU_GUEST, - VIR_DOMAIN_AFFECT_CONFIG, + VIR_DOMAIN_VCPU_CONFIG, error); virCheckNonZeroArgGoto(nvcpus, error); diff --git a/src/qemu/qemu_driver.c b/src/qemu/qemu_driver.c index c6d18f6575b7..48cad937d8bb 100644 --- a/src/qemu/qemu_driver.c +++ b/src/qemu/qemu_driver.c @@ -4331,8 +4331,8 @@ qemuDomainSetVcpusFlags(virDomainPtr dom, bool useAgent = !!(flags & VIR_DOMAIN_VCPU_GUEST); int ret = -1; - virCheckFlags(VIR_DOMAIN_AFFECT_LIVE | - VIR_DOMAIN_AFFECT_CONFIG | + virCheckFlags(VIR_DOMAIN_VCPU_LIVE | + VIR_DOMAIN_VCPU_CONFIG | VIR_DOMAIN_VCPU_MAXIMUM | VIR_DOMAIN_VCPU_GUEST | VIR_DOMAIN_VCPU_HOTPLUGGABLE | @@ -19377,8 +19377,8 @@ qemuDomainSetVcpu(virDomainPtr dom, ssize_t lastvcpu; int ret = -1; - virCheckFlags(VIR_DOMAIN_AFFECT_LIVE | - VIR_DOMAIN_AFFECT_CONFIG | + virCheckFlags(VIR_DOMAIN_SETVCPU_AFFECT_LIVE | + VIR_DOMAIN_SETVCPU_AFFECT_CONFIG | VIR_DOMAIN_SETVCPU_ASYNC_UNPLUG, -1); if (state != 0 && state != 1) { diff --git a/tools/virsh-domain.c b/tools/virsh-domain.c index 76369e8694ce..513129cda71b 100644 --- a/tools/virsh-domain.c +++ b/tools/virsh-domain.c @@ -7696,9 +7696,9 @@ cmdSetvcpus(vshControl *ctl, const vshCmd *cmd) VSH_REQUIRE_OPTION_VAR(maximum, config); if (config) - flags |= VIR_DOMAIN_AFFECT_CONFIG; + flags |= VIR_DOMAIN_VCPU_CONFIG; if (live) - flags |= VIR_DOMAIN_AFFECT_LIVE; + flags |= VIR_DOMAIN_VCPU_LIVE; if (guest) flags |= VIR_DOMAIN_VCPU_GUEST; if (maximum) @@ -7867,9 +7867,9 @@ cmdSetvcpu(vshControl *ctl, const vshCmd *cmd) VSH_EXCLUSIVE_OPTIONS("async", "enable"); if (config) - flags |= VIR_DOMAIN_AFFECT_CONFIG; + flags |= VIR_DOMAIN_SETVCPU_AFFECT_CONFIG; if (live) - flags |= VIR_DOMAIN_AFFECT_LIVE; + flags |= VIR_DOMAIN_SETVCPU_AFFECT_LIVE; if (async) flags |= VIR_DOMAIN_SETVCPU_ASYNC_UNPLUG; -- 2.47.3
